Search continues for three grizzly bears after students, teachers attacked in B.C.

November 22, 2025

More conservation officers arrived in this central coast community Saturday to join the search for three grizzly bears that witnesses have said were in the area when a group of schoolchildren was attacked.

Four people – a teacher and three young students – were airlifted to hospital Thursday after the attack. They were among a school group of Grades 4 and 5 students. In all, 11 were injured.

The Nova Scotia RCMP says it's not aware of any fentanyl-laced cannabis being sold by unauthorized cannabis retailers in the province, after the premier made this claim in a news conference last week. The claim raises tensions with Mi'kmaw communities amid a province-wide crackdown aimed largely at on-reserve cannabis dispensaries.
